THE PRINCETON REVIEW GETS RESULTS. Get extra preparation for an excellent AP U.S. Government & Politics score with 550 extra practice questions and answers. This eBook edition has been optimized for digital reading with cross-linked questions, answers, and explanations.

Practice makes perfect—and The Princeton Review’s 550 AP U.S. Government & Politics Practice Questions gives you everything you need to work your way to the top. Inside, you’ll find proven tips and strategies for tackling and overcoming challenging questions, and all the practice you need to get the score you want.

Inside The Book: All the Practice and Strategies You Need
2 comprehensive practice tests, including a diagnostic exam to help you identify areas of improvement
• Over 420 additional practice questions
• Step-by-step techniques for both multiple-choice and free-response questions
• Practice drills for each tested topic: Constitutional Underpinnings; Political Beliefs and Behaviors; Political Parties, Interest Groups, and Mass Media; Institutions; Public Policy; and Civil Rights and Civil Liberties
• Answer keys and detailed explanations for each drill and test question
• Engaging guidance to help you critically assess your progress
